Abstract:
A gauge for measuring the depth of a hole countersink in a workpiece for a fastener, or for measuring the protrusion height of a fastener head above the surface of the workpiece, includes a tapered cylindrical case for holding a transducer such as an LVDT, and a probe assembly removably mounted on the lower end of the case. The probe assembly includes a foot having an annular contact ring at its lower end for contacting the workpiece around the hole or around the fastener head to establish the reference position from which the measurement is to be taken. A probe is mounted in a well in the foot for axial sliding movement therein and is captured within the food by a connector which is screwed onto the upper end of the foot. The connector screws into the lower end of the case and a stud of the LVDT extends through a bore in the end of the case and the connector to contact the top end of the probe on measure the axial position of the probe while it is sensing the countersink depth or the fastener head protrusion. A cable connects the LVDT to a digital indicator to provide a readout of the measurement taken.
